Product Description
The Lincat J10 is a floor-standing twin tank gas fryer built for commercial kitchens that need to run two separate frying operations at the same time. Each tank operates independently with its own thermostatic control, which means different products can be cooked at different temperatures simultaneously — a practical arrangement when service demands are high and the menu calls for a range of fried items.
In a working kitchen, the twin tank layout allows operators to dedicate one side to battered or breaded products and the other to chips or lighter items, reducing flavour transfer and keeping results consistent across both. Beneath each tank, a deep cool zone collects food debris before it has a chance to burn in the hot oil. This keeps the cooking medium cleaner for longer and makes a measurable difference to oil life over the course of a busy week.
From an operational standpoint, the J10 offers several practical advantages:
- Independent thermostatic control on each tank for separate product cooking
- Cool zone design reduces burnt debris and extends oil life
- Piezo ignition with pilot flame for reliable, straightforward start-up
- Flame failure device and high-temperature cut-out for safe operation
- Heavy-duty baskets, batter plates and stainless steel lids supplied as standard
The J10 requires a natural gas or LPG supply depending on the specification ordered, and as a floor-standing unit it needs adequate clearance for ventilation and safe access. Installation beneath a suitable extraction canopy is required in line with commercial kitchen ventilation standards. Its weight and footprint make it a permanent fixture in most kitchens, so placement is worth thinking through carefully at the planning stage rather than after installation.
The J10 is well suited to pubs, fish and chip operations, café kitchens and mid-sized restaurant sites where twin-tank frying capacity is needed without stepping up to a larger multi-tank range. For higher-volume operations — large-scale takeaways or high-throughput catering sites running extended service periods — a heavier-duty model with greater tank capacity may be a more appropriate fit. Equally, if your current fryer is a single-tank unit that struggles at peak times, the J10 represents a practical step up.

Specifications
- Capacity (litres)
- 28
- External depth (mm)
- 770
- External height (mm)
- 1060
- External width (mm)
- 600
- Number of baskets
- 2
- Number of tanks
- 2
- Power rating (kw)
- 24
- Power type
- Natural Gas|LPG
- Temperature range (deg c)
- 110 - 190
- Weight (kg)
- 54
